Pax and I made some invites a few weeks back! They were quite simple to make. For the pin, we printed the info on white cardstock, cut it out in the shape of a bowling pin, and cut some red cardstock for stripes. Then took black cardstock, traced a circle, cut it out, and used a hole punch for the 3 holes. Then a little brad to attach the two so you could move it around to fit in an envelope!

We had a hard time finding eco-friendly party favors, but decided on these water bottles. I found them on Amazon, they are BPA free, biodegradable, recyclable, and reusable. I put a Ben 10 watch around each one, attached a balloon, and called them Ben 10 water bottles! Pax was sold, so that’s what we gave out!
